Appeals court overturns paramedics' convictions in Elijah McClain death

June 5, 2026

Summary

The Colorado Court of Appeals reversed the criminally negligent homicide convictions for two former paramedics involved in the death of Elijah McClain. The paramedics had injected ketamine into McClain.

How coverage differs

Left outlets emphasize the ruling's impact on justice for Elijah McClain's family and accountability, while right outlets focus on the significant development for the paramedics and reevaluation of legal proceedings.

  • Left: Justice denied: Paramedics' convictions overturned in Elijah McClain death Left-leaning outlets report the appeals court's decision to reverse the convictions of former paramedics Jeremy Cooper and Peter Cichuniec in the death of Elijah McClain. They emphasize the impact of this ruling on the pursuit of justice for McClain's family and the broader implications for accountability in cases involving law enforcement and medical personnel.
  • Right: Appeals court's decision to overturn the convictions of paramedics Jeremy Cooper Right-leaning outlets focus on the Colorado Court of Appeals overturning the convictions of paramedics Jeremy Cooper and Peter Cichuniec, who were found guilty in the death of Elijah McClain. They frame the reversal as a significant development for the paramedics, suggesting a reevaluation of the initial legal proceedings.
